Clean Energy Siting and Permitting Project (CESP)

What is the Kittitas County CESP Project?

In February 2026 Kittitas County entered into a contract with the Washington State Department of Commerce to execute a CESP grant awarded in November of 2025. The grant will fund a Programmatic Environmental Impact Statement to assist in siting of clean energy facilities within Kittitas County.

Programmatic Environmental Impact Statement (PEIS)

This Programmatic Environmental Impact Statement will be a county-wide assessment of alternative energy development and siting standards. The project will follow a general EIS process including scoping, stakeholder/public/agency input, development of alternatives and selection of alternatives. The "programmatic" element is because the County is initiating this review without any specific project proposal in mind and with the hopes of providing a framework for alternative energy developers that is predictable, environmentally responsible, and in line with community interests. The County wil host stakeholder meetings, public input workshops, comment periods and multiple public hearings throughout this process. In addition to the PEIS the County will revisit our alternative energy development regulations to reflect the results of the PEIS. The project is scheduled for completion by June 2027.

Project Goals

The Kittitas County CESP Project goals are to:

  • Determine what energy types are most suitable for permitting,
  • Retain local control of permitting in Kittitas County for identified energy projects,
  • Develop and/or modify county code, where appropriate, so project applicants and the public understand:
    • Where uses may be appropriate,
    • What studies and information are necessary to evaluate applications, and
    • The types of mitigation which may be appropriate for energy projects that are proposed in Kittitas County.
  • Where energy uses may be appropriate, create a streamlined permitting process.

Project Process and Schedule

The CESP Project is expected to take place over several phases beginning in February 2026 and ending in June 2027.

Key milestones include

  • Selection of energy uses to study
  • Preparation and release of draft EIS
  • Select a preferred energy siting and permitting approach
  • Issue final EIS
  • Develop and adopt updated permitting process based on the CESP Project findings

How to Get Involved

Throughout the project, opportunities to learn more and share your input will be posted on the project website and social media.

Key opportunities to share your voice include

  • Attend an open house to learn about the project and share comments,
  • Submit comments online or in writing,
  • Visit our table at community events as the project progresses, and/or
  • Attend public meetings when draft development regulations are released

Additional engagement activities include coordination with agencies, Tribal governments, stakeholders, and regular updates to the Board of County Commissioners.
